Grandma's Chopped Liver
I was staying with my elderly mother and she was having problems with anemia. In addition to her iron supplement I looked up on the internet other iron rich foods that I could make for her. Liver is right up there at the top and I found this recipe. OMG it is good! The three textures of onion (boiled, fried and raw) plus the hard boiled eggs add tons to the texture and flavor. Reminds me of when we used to get really good chopped chicken livers from the Jewish deli as a kid. Now I make it all the time. It's so easy! Thanks for sharing AJ.

Vegetarian Bean Curry
I have made this a number of times. Wonderful! Great as-is but I made a couple of modifications on later tries that I liked too. I use 3 different color beans (plus the kidney bean is one I just don't care for). Use the special multi-color jumbo raisins for a beautiful presentation. Once I added an extra can of tomatoes right at the end and they were larger pieces and bright red and the contrast was beautiful. I have also added coconut milk sometimes and that was very nice too. Very easy! I used the small orange lentils as suggested and they worked perfectly every time without having to pre-cook them. Just love this recipe and it is quite easy. Also nice to know I have a really fabulous thing to serve my vegetarian friends.
